Main Features:

  • 7 levels of stimulation
  • 5 sensitivity settings for different dog’s temperament
  • Small and lightweight collar
  • Water resistant collar, operated by 6V alkaline battery
  • LED indicator for battery and operation

ON-OFF & Intensity Dial

The ON-OFF & Intensity Dial on the collar is used to turn the DMT Advance Bark Collar on and off to select the intensity level.

Set the ON-OFF & Intensity Dial to the “OFF” position to turn off the DMT Advance Bark Collar.

Level 1 is the lowest level of stimulation and Level 7 is the highest.

The DMT Advance bark collar has a built in safety feature which will automatically shut off for 1 minute if it is activated 5 times or more. The LED light will flash Red and Green during this period of time. Then the light will be off to indicate it is back to sleep mode.

Sensitivity Dial

The sensitivity dial is used to adjust the sensitivity level of the vibration sensor. Level 5 is the highest sensitive level and level 1 is the lowest. This means the collar is easy to activate in level 5 and then less chance to activate at level 1.

Installing the Battery

  1. Use a 10 cent coin to open the battery screw cap.
  2. Insert the 6V alkaline battery into the battery tray with the negative (-) facing inside (SEE DIAGRAM)
  3. Use the 10 cent coin to screw the battery cap back onto the collar

Please note: If the LED indicator flashes Red when the collar is turned on, it means the battery needs to be replaced.

Testing

  1. Turn the “Intensity” level to 1 and the “Sensitivity Dial” to level 5
  2. Test by scratching the rough surface of the test tool on the collar (as shown in the diagram) using a coin or a pen. The LED light should flash Green to indicate the collar is working.

Fitting the Collar

The collar strap should be adjusted so that the contact points are held firmly against the dog’s skin. Fasten the collar enough to allow one or two fingers to fit between the collar strap and your dog’s neck.

If the collar is too loose, it will be ineffective because there is no contact between the dogs’ skin and the contact points. Collar should not be used for more than 10 hours per day. If a rash develops, discontinue use.

Regular Maintenance

  • Check Contact Points for tightness weekly, do not over tighten.
  • Clean Contact Points with alcohol/metho weekly
  • Replace Battery when it is required (Note: make sure the collar is turned off for checking and cleaning.)
  • Check your dog’s neck for irritation and wash neck weekly.
